经过数字签名的应用程序有可能感染病毒吗?

经过数字签名的应用程序有可能感染病毒吗?

我从大学电脑上下载了“java 开发工具包”,我用来下载该软件的电脑里充满了病毒和恶意软件。我用杀毒软件扫描了该软件,软件没有问题。我检查了软件属性,发现该软件上有数字签名。

数字签名快照

所以我想问以下两个问题:

  1. 应用程序上的数字签名是否可以保证它没有被病毒感染或以任何方式被更改?

  2. 软件感染病毒后,数字签名还能保持完整吗?

答案1

是的, 可能的,但您不太可能会受到这种事情的影响。然而,这种事情确实会发生。

A电子签名并不能保证程序没有恶意软件 - 是的,它应该可以,但如果有人入侵数据库并窃取数字签名/证书,他们就可以签署任何他们想要的东西。如果验证路径可以信任,那么数字签名将表明程序的完整性是否受到损害(即程序在签名后是否被修改过)。

相关内容